Пример #1
0
        public override void HandleMessage(Yupi.Model.Domain.Habbo session, Yupi.Protocol.Buffers.ClientMessage request,
                                           Yupi.Protocol.IRouter router)
        {
            if (session.RoomEntity == null)
            {
                return;
            }

            session.RoomEntity.Wake();

            int danceId = request.GetInteger();

            Dance dance;

            if (Dance.TryFromInt32(danceId, out dance))
            {
                // TODO Remove Item from hand
                session.RoomEntity.SetDance(dance);
            }
        }